About 33 Broad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

33 Broad Lane is a detached house in Upper Bucklebury, Reading, Reading (RG7 6QH). It has a recorded floor area of 189 m² (around 2034 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(December 2017)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2015.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 73). Main heating runs on oil.

At 189 m² it's 18.1% larger than the typical home in the postcode (160 m² median across 18 EPCs). One historical planning record sits against the property in 2022.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
